Detailed explanation-1: -Operant conditioning changes behaviors by using consequences, and these consequences will have two characteristics: Reinforcement or punishment.
Detailed explanation-2: -Punishment is when a particular behavior occurs, a consequence immediately follow the behavior, and as a result, the behavior is less likely to occur again in the future (behavior is weakened).
Detailed explanation-3: -The four consequences of behavior include positive reinforcement, negative reinforcement, positive punishment, and negative punishment.
Detailed explanation-4: -Consequences: Reinforcement and Punishment As one of the most important principles of behavior analysis, the process of reinforcement entails a consequence that increases the future likelihood of the behavior it follows. Such behavior change occurs over time following immediate reinforcement.
